Balcones District Park, Austin, TX Local Guide

Cheapest Available Balcones District Park Apartments for Rent

 

The cheapest available apartment rental in the Balcones District Park area of Austin, TX is a 1 Bed unit found at Onyx183 priced from $880. Milo has the second lowest priced unit, which is a 1 Bed apartment currently listed from $891. Here are the most affordable Balcones District Park apartments for rent in Austin, TX:

Apartment ListingModel NameBed/BathPriced From
Onyx183ASCOT1BR,1BA$880
MiloA11BR,1BA$891
Radius at The DomainA21BR,1BA$974
Studio DomainS1Studio,1BA$980
Elysium Grand LLPA11BR,1BA$1,010

Frequently Asked Questions about Cheap Balcones District Park Apartments

What is a cheap apartment in Balcones District Park?

A cheap apartment is any apartment up to the 30% percentile of cost for the area, which in Balcones District Park is under $1,205.

What is the price of a cheap apartment in Balcones District Park?

The cheapest apartment in Balcones District Park is Onyx183 which is listed at $880, while the average apartment in Balcones District Park costs $2,014.

What types of apartments are the cheapest in Balcones District Park?

Student, low-income, and by-the-bed apartments are typically the cheapest rentals in most cities, though they require qualifying criteria to rent. There are 22 regular apartments in Balcones District Park that we think qualify as ‘cheap apartments’ that do not have special requirements to apply to rent.
